Garnish: Lemon Twist Source: The Art of Drink, March 2007 2 ounces of Scotch to 1 ounce of Drambuie, build on ice in a rocks or old fashion glass and garnish with a lemon twist. Extratasty won't distinguish between scotch and drambuie. Per Wikipedia, "Drambuie (dram 'boo ee or dram 'byoo ee) is a honey- and herb-flavoured golden scotch whisky liqueur made from aged malt whisky, heather honey and a secret blend of herbs and spices. The flavor suggests saffron, honey, anise, nutmeg and an herbal earthiness." |
